About Joséphine Groslambert
Joséphine Groslambert is a scholar working on Physiology, Oncology and Immunology, having authored 6 papers that have together received 251 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include PARP inhibition in cancer therapy (6 papers), DNA Repair Mechanisms (4 papers) and Cell death mechanisms and regulation (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Physiology (40 citations), Oncology (212 citations) and Immunology (65 citations). Joséphine Groslambert has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Denmark. Frequent co-authors include Ivan Ahel, Evgeniia Prokhorova, Dragana Ahel, Thomas Agnew, Michael L. Nielsen, Marcin J. Suskiewicz, Roderick J. O’Sullivan, Anne R. Wondisford, Valentina Zorzini and John Brognard.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Communications, Molecular Cell and Nature Structural & Molecular Biology.
